A major motor company displays a die-cast model of its first automobile, made from 6.60 kg of iron. To celebrate its hundredth year in business, a worker will recast the model in gold from the original dies. What mass of gold is needed to make the new model? The density of iron is 7.86 103 kg/m3, and that of gold is 19.30 103 kg/m3
